Sierra and Downey pushed the score to 12-7 the last time they played Downey, but on Thursday defenses reigned supreme. The Timberwolves narrowly escaped with a win as the squad sidled past the Knights 3-1. The victory continues a trend for the Timberwolves in their matchups with the Knights: they've now won three in a row.

Koa Rodrigues spent all seven innings on the mound, and it's clear why: he surrendered only one earned run on five hits and racked up seven Ks. He has been consistent recently: he hasn't given up more than two walks in four consecutive appearances.

On the hitting side, Sierra's win was truly a team effort as five different players contributed at least one hit. One of them was Chad Simas Jr., who went 1-for-4 with one run and one RBI.

Sierra's victory bumped their record up to 9-13. As for Downey, they are on a five-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 6-13.

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Sierra will face off against Patterson at 4:00 p.m. on Monday. As for Downey, they will take on Pitman at 4:00 p.m. on Monday.
